  • Discoverer Portlet fails with ora-01017

    This is about OAS 10gR2
    Middle tier version: 10.1.2.0.2
    Discoverer version: 10.1.2.48.18
    I've manually changed password for Discoverer EUL Owner schema (using "alter user blablabla identified by blablabla" statement, in sqlplus) and now I can't register discoverer portlet provider.
    It fails with the following message:
    "Error!
    BaseException is ... ORA-01017: invalid username/password; logon denied
    Recognizing component versions...
    ptlshare.jar version: 10.1.2.0.2
    pdkjava.jar version: 10.1.2.0.0"
    I make no idea what was the password for discover5 schema before and that was the reason i changed it.
    Already have redeployed discoverer.ear file in OAS administration, but it didn't change a thing.
    I've tried the Discoverer Forum but no one there answered my question.
    Any ideas of what could bring this kind of issue?
    TIA
    Marcos

    Solved!
    The problem was that when I changed user password in database, i did not synchronized Database user with OID attributes.
    Step by step solution:
    Reset Password for DB user in sqlplus with
    "Alter user XXXX identified by YYYYYY;"
    Enter OID (Oracle Directory Management) as the "superuser" (ORCLADMIN);
    Navigate to
    -> Entry Management
    -> cn=OracleContext
    -> cn=Product
    -> cn=IAS
    -> cn=IAS InfraStructure Databases
    -> cn=orclReferenceName=appsdb.ecovias.com.br
    -> OrclResourceName=DISCOVERER5
    Alter orclPasswordattribute for the user, using the same password you have resetted in Sqlplus.
    Bounce OAS middle tier instance (ompnctl startall/stopall or using Application Server Control).
    Touché, it's done!

    You can find the port usage by executing opmnctl status -l from the command line. This should give you the port usage for each opmn-governed component. In a standard setup, web cache normally runs on port 7777 while Oracle HTTP Server runs on 7778. Alternatively, you can check the httpd.conf for the parameter Listen. This will give you the Oracle HTTP Server port as well.
